RE: Battle O' Baltimore-August 11 Directions to Site
Directions to Western School of Technology for Battle O' Baltimore:
The Western School of Technology is located in Catonsville just inside the Baltimore Beltway (I-695) on the southwest corner of the city. Whether you are coming from the North on the outer loop or the south/east on the inner loop, you will take exit 12, Wilkens Avenue. The only trick is that the most direct route to the school is an access road that is shared by the ramp to the freeway. Coming from the North on the outer loop, take the sign for Exit 12 BC and turn right onto Wilkens Avenue, looping back under I-695. Immediately after the underpass, turn left at the sign indicating the entrance to I-695 North, but instead of turning left to get on the highway, continue straight on the access road. Western is about a half-mile on the left. Coming from the south and east on the inner loop, exit onto the second exit 12 (Wilkens Avenue West). At the end of the ramp, turn left onto the access road and proceed about a half-mile to the school. |
